6455 La Jolla Blvd sits in the scenic La Jolla area of California. This building lies near the intersection of La Jolla Shores Drive and Calle Frescota. The Pacific Ocean is close, adding a lovely coastal feel. Windansea Beach is nearby, creating a relaxing atmosphere with peaceful mountain vistas around.
The building has a low-rise design with just 1 story and 22 units. It was built in 1970. Unit sizes range from 713 to 989 square feet. Options include both 1-bedroom and 2-bedroom layouts. Private balconies in multiple units allow for outdoor enjoyment.
Recent sales show unit prices between $860,000 and $875,000. The lowest sold price in the last 12 months was about $605,000. The average closed price stands at $690,000, with an average price per square foot of $862. Units spend about 157 days on the market before selling.
Amenities enhance daily living. Residents can enjoy a pool, hot tub, and fitness center. A recreation room supports social activities. Meeting rooms are available for gatherings, and sidewalks help with easy access around the property. The clubhouse offers another space for community interaction.
The location offers dining options close by, such as Windan Sea Cafe and Barleyanfigs. La Jolla Methodist Church serves as a nearby public school, while local shops cater to everyday needs. The building lies in an area rich with entertainment, making it a desirable spot for residents.

La Jolla is a coastal village known for its dramatic cliffs, rocky coves, and sandy beaches. The area features a famous cove, tide pools, and sea life viewing along the shore. This district offers local art galleries, boutique shops, cafes, and a wide range of popular restaurants. You can walk coastal trails and hike at Torrey Pines State Natural Reserve nearby. Regional buses run through the district, and I-5 plus nearby roads provide direct car access to downtown San Diego.
